军校编程主要学习什么

fiy 其他 31

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    军校编程主要学习的内容可以分为以下几个方面:

    1. 基础编程知识:军校编程课程从基础开始,教授学生基本的编程知识、数据结构和算法。学生需要学习各种编程语言(如C、C++、Java等),掌握变量、函数、类、对象等基本概念。同时,还需要学习常见的数据结构(如数组、链表、栈、队列、树等)和算法(如排序、查找、图算法等)。

    2. 网络编程:在军队中,网络通信非常重要。因此,军校编程也会教授网络编程的知识,包括Socket编程、TCP/IP协议、HTTP协议等。学生需要了解网络通信的原理和技术,能够编写简单的网络应用程序。

    3. 操作系统:军队中的一些任务需要在特定的操作系统环境下进行。因此,军校编程也会涉及操作系统的学习,包括进程管理、内存管理、文件系统等。学生需要了解操作系统的原理和功能,并能够编写简单的操作系统相关的程序。

    4. 数据库:军队中需要处理大量的数据和信息,因此,数据库的知识也是军校编程的一部分。学生需要学习数据库的基本概念、SQL语言的使用,以及常见的数据库管理系统(如MySQL、Oracle等)的操作和维护。

    5. 安全编程:信息安全对于军队来说至关重要。因此,军校编程也会注重培养学生的安全编程能力,包括编写安全的网络应用程序、防范网络攻击和入侵等。

    总之,军校编程主要学习的内容涵盖了基础的编程知识、网络编程、操作系统、数据库以及安全编程等方面。这些知识将为军队的信息化建设提供必要的支持,使学生具备能够在军队信息化建设中发挥作用的专业技能。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    军校编程主要学习以下内容:

    1. 编程基础知识:军校编程课程将覆盖编程的基本概念和技能,包括算法和数据结构、编程语言(如C、C++、Python等)、程序设计等。学生将学习如何编写代码、调试和测试程序,以及解决实际问题的能力。

    2. 信息安全和网络安全:军校编程课程将强调信息安全和网络安全的重要性。学生将学习如何保护计算机系统和网络免受恶意攻击、黑客入侵和数据泄露等问题。他们将了解不同类型的安全威胁,并学习如何应对和防范这些威胁。

    3. 网络编程和网络通信:军队中的通信起着至关重要的作用。军校编程课程将培养学生在网络编程方面的技能,包括socket编程、远程访问、网络协议等。学生将学习如何构建并维护可靠的网络通信系统,以支持军队的通信需求。

    4. 人工智能和机器学习:人工智能和机器学习在当今军事领域扮演着重要的角色。军校编程课程将介绍学生如何使用人工智能技术和机器学习算法来处理大规模数据、进行模式识别、智能决策等。学生将掌握构建智能系统和机器学习模型的能力。

    5. 军事仿真和虚拟现实:军事仿真和虚拟现实技术在军事训练和战争规划中起着重要作用。军校编程课程将教授学生如何使用计算机编程技术开发军事仿真系统和虚拟现实应用。学生将学习如何设计和实现逼真的虚拟环境,以帮助军事决策和训练。

    总的来说,军校编程的课程将培养学生在计算机编程和信息技术方面的技能,以满足军队的需求。这些技能包括编程基础知识、信息安全和网络安全、网络编程和通信、人工智能与机器学习、军事仿真和虚拟现实等。学生将在课程中学习如何使用计算机编程技术来解决军事领域的挑战,并为国家的安全和国防做出贡献。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    军校编程主要学习计算机科学和编程技术,培养学员具备解决复杂问题、开发和维护软件系统的能力。具体而言,军校编程主要学习以下内容:

    1. 基础知识:学员将学习计算机科学的基础知识,包括计算机体系结构、数据结构与算法、操作系统、数据库等。这些知识将为学员提供编程的基础。

    2. 编程语言:学员将学习主流的编程语言,如C、C++、Java等。他们将学习语言的语法、数据类型、控制结构、函数、类等。这些知识将帮助他们理解和编写程序。

    3. 算法与数据结构:学员将学习常用的数据结构和算法,如数组、链表、栈、队列、树、图等。他们将学习如何选择和实现合适的数据结构和算法解决问题。

    4. 软件工程:学员将学习软件开发的基本流程和方法,包括需求分析、设计、编码、测试、部署等。他们将学习如何进行团队合作和项目管理。

    5. 网络编程:学员将学习网络编程的基本概念和技术,包括TCP/IP协议栈、Socket编程等。他们将学习如何开发网络应用程序,并理解网络通信的原理和机制。

    6. 数据库:学员将学习数据库的基本概念和技术,包括关系型数据库的设计和操作、SQL语言等。他们将学习如何在程序中使用数据库进行数据存储和检索。

    7. 软件安全:学员将学习软件安全的基本概念和技术,包括密码学、网络安全、漏洞分析等。他们将了解常见的安全威胁和攻击方式,并学习如何保护软件系统。

    总之,军校编程的目标是培养具备计算机科学和编程技术的军事人才,他们将能够使用计算机和软件解决复杂问题,提高军队的信息化水平和作战能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部